PIU timing is -way- easier than any other rhythm game -- the only exception is the PIU Pro series. Even on hard difficulty in the operator menu, it's barely up to par with ITG's window tightness.

Of course, the Hard Judgment mod changes things a bit.

PIU is a nice change from DDR/ITG, but I'd never play it as seriously as I have/would like to play ITG. Although over here in the UK we're sorely lacking in the 4-panel department but have recently acquired a PIU Pro 2, PIU Fiesta 2, and we'll be getting an Infinity when that becomes available. They're getting played a lot and are great fun, but if we get a decent ITG machine 90% of the players will be straight over to that >_>

The scene seems odd. I think the community on the official site seems to be okay, but since most of the scene is Korean/Mexican from my understanding it's not easy to talk to most players XD

In the UK the community either just meet at the arcades, or hijack space on DDR forums!
